Windows 11 22H2 Support Ends This October, Forcing Enterprise Upgrades

Windows 11 22H2 Support Ends This October, Forcing Enterprise Upgrades

Microsoft has announced that Windows 11 22H2 Enterprise, Education, and IoT Enterprise editions will reach end of servicing on October 14, 2025, ceasing critical security updates. Unmanaged devices will auto-upgrade to Windows 24H2, but safeguard holds could complicate transitions for systems with incompatible drivers. This deadline underscores the perpetual race against vulnerabilities in aging OS versions.
FTC Warns: Amazon Refund Text Scam Targets Consumers in Latest Phishing Wave

FTC Warns: Amazon Refund Text Scam Targets Consumers in Latest Phishing Wave

The Federal Trade Commission has issued an urgent alert about fraudulent SMS messages impersonating Amazon to steal payment credentials. These sophisticated scams lure victims with fake refund offers for 'recalled items' through malicious links. Security experts detail how to identify and report these attacks before they compromise sensitive data.
